    The Hutcheson Journalism Scholarship is designed for U.S. students attending Texas Tech University College of Media and Communication. Eligible applicants are sophomores, juniors, or seniors pursuing a bachelor's degree in journalism with a minimum 2.50 GPA and demonstrated financial need. The application deadline is April 15, 2026.
